RAVINDRA Himte, All India General Secretary of Bharatiya Mazdoor Sangh (BMS), said, “Women’s participation in labour sector is important for the development of the Indian society. About 67 crore women have increased their participation in the labour sector in the previous year.” He was speaking at the conclusion ceremony of the two-day ‘Mahila Abhas Warg’ (women’s study class) programme organised by Bharatiya Mazdoor Sangh (BMS), Vidarbha Region, recently.
 
All India Vice President Neeta Choubey, Senior Leader of BMS Vasantrao Pimpalpure, State General Secretary Gajanan Gatlewar and ‘Mahila Abhas Warg’ General Secretary and Coordinator Suhastai Tiwari, Vidarbha Region President Ravindra Ganesh and other leaders were present, informs Suresh Chaudhary, Head of Publicity and Social Media, BMS.
